我已经在 Ubuntu 机器上设置了一个 squid 代理,我想通过从另一台计算机(不在同一局域网上)访问代理来做一些测试。但是我好像连接不上squid代理服务器。
我尝试了几种不同的连接方式:在我的网络浏览器中设置代理,以及使用 unix 程序“curl”从命令行发出 http 请求。但我就是无法连接。
我已经尝试在配置文件 squid.conf 中设置 acl 以允许从远程机器进行访问。所以我不知道发生了什么。如果我尝试从 squid 代理所在的同一台机器访问互联网,它会正常工作。
我在 squid.conf 中添加的允许从远程机器访问的行是:
acl my_machine src 50.193.61.125/255.255.255.0
http_access allow my_machine
是否需要做任何其他事情来允许远程机器访问 squid 代理?
谢谢。
最佳答案
遇到了同样的问题。使用 fedora 19 操作系统和 squid 3.2.9 的 ec2 实例。还为端口 3128 创建了一个安全组传入规则。如果我从远程 pc 连接,将无法工作。认为 aws-cloud 中存在限制。
关于proxy - 无法从远程机器访问鱿鱼代理,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17818134/